From e525ea027439214251522a36317879235c729e27 Mon Sep 17 00:00:00 2001 From: Hektor Misplon Date: Wed, 5 Feb 2025 01:11:50 +0100 Subject: [PATCH] Add 'setup-gnome' script --- .bin/setup-gnome | 36 ++++++++++++++++++++++++++++++++++++ 1 file changed, 36 insertions(+) create mode 100755 .bin/setup-gnome diff --git a/.bin/setup-gnome b/.bin/setup-gnome new file mode 100755 index 0000000..f856137 --- /dev/null +++ b/.bin/setup-gnome @@ -0,0 +1,36 @@ +#!/usr/bin/env bash + +gsettings set org.gnome.desktop.background primary-color "#555555" + +gsettings set org.gnome.desktop.wm.preferences workspace-names "['sh', 'www', 'dev', 'info', 'etc']" +gsettings set org.gnome.desktop.wm.keybindings close "['Delete']" +gsettings set org.gnome.desktop.wm.keybindings switch-applications "['j']" +gsettings set org.gnome.desktop.wm.keybindings switch-applications-backward "['k']" +gsettings set org.gnome.shell.keybindings toggle-application-view "['p']" +gsettings set org.gnome.mutter center-new-windows true +gsettings set org.gnome.shell.keybindings toggle-quick-settings [] + +g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-1 "['a']" +g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-2 "['s']" +g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-3 "['d']" +g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-4 "['f']" +g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-5 "['g']" +gsettings set org.gnome.desktop.wm.keybindings move-to-workspace-1 "['a']" +gsettings set org.gnome.desktop.wm.keybindings move-to-workspace-2 "['s']" +gsettings set org.gnome.desktop.wm.keybindings move-to-workspace-3 "['d']" +gsettings set org.gnome.desktop.wm.keybindings move-to-workspace-4 "['f']" +gsettings set org.gnome.desktop.wm.keybindings move-to-workspace-5 "['g']" + +gsettings set org.gnome.settings-daemon.plugins.media-keys custom-keybindings "['/org/gnome/settings-daemon/plugins/media-keys/custom-keybindings/custom1/']" +gsettings set org.gnome.settings-daemon.plugins.media-keys.custom-keybinding:/org/gnome/settings-daemon/plugins/media-keys/custom-keybindings/custom1/ name "Alacritty" +gsettings set org.gnome.settings-daemon.plugins.media-keys.custom-keybinding:/org/gnome/settings-daemon/plugins/media-keys/custom-keybindings/custom1/ command "alacritty" +gsettings set org.gnome.settings-daemon.plugins.media-keys.custom-keybinding:/org/gnome/settings-daemon/plugins/media-keys/custom-keybindings/custom1/ binding "Return" + +gsettings set org.gnome.shell.keybindings screenshot "['Print']" + +gsettings set org.gnome.desktop.wm.preferences num-workspaces "5" +gsettings set org.gnome.mutter dynamic-workspaces "false" +gsettings set org.gnome.shell.extensions.window-list display-all-workspaces "true" +gsettings set org.gnome.shell.app-switcher current-workspace-only "true" + +gsettings set org.gnome.login-screen logo ''